**Your Opportunity**:
The Meeting Room Technology Coordinator (MRTC) provides onsite support at highly confi dential meetings andtheir required meeting room technologies for Governing Council Chamber and Governing Council Boardroom, President’s Boardroom, and other Simcoe Hall meeting rooms including providing support outside of regular working hours (i.e. evenings, weekends). The MRTC regularly attends University executive and senior administrative meetings that include strategic discussions of labour relations, collective bargaining including contingency planning, labour issues management, University governance, academic tribunals, meetings pertaining to strategic human resource matters, senior board and committee meetings. The Meeting Room Technology Coordinator (MRTC) has responsibility for the function of meeting room technical equipment; setting up audio-visual (a/v) equipment and providing on-site, live running of equipment during audio and video conferencing for senior level meetings; including set-up of complex connections between remote facilities. The Coordinator is responsible for ensuring the quality of legally required audio recordings and video testimony for Appeals,Discipline, and Faculty Grievance (ADFG) hearings; liaises directly with the A/V vendor as well as other institutional and divisional IT resources to troubleshoot technical issues. The MRTC works to ensure appropriate upgrades and repairs to room technologies are scheduled with the A/V vendor after consultation with stakeholders.
**Q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ED**
**EDUCATION**:Three (3) year college diploma or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
**EXPERIENCE**:Three (3) years related work experience with in a service and/or production unit with in-depth knowledge of sophisticated audio-visual equipment, associated peripheral equipment (cameras, speakers, projectors, computers, monitors). Experience in standard office software, communications packages such as Skype for Business, transmission protocols and AV codecs.
**SKILLS**: Strong commitment to high quality service, professionalism, and teamwork. Excellent customer service skills with the ability to gain customer confidence and trust.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to convey information to customers who have varying levels of technical knowledge. Excellent problem solving skills. Good administration skills, demonstrating attention to detail and the ability to prioritize. Critical requirement to protect the confidentiality of information presented at meetings. Excellent technical, and problem-solving capabilities.
**OTHER**: Must have the ability to perform duties in a busy, service-oriented department; work well under pressure to meet strict deadlines; deal with senior-level client requests in a live-troubleshooting mode. Demonstrated ability to adapt to shifting priorities, demands and timelines, demonstrated problem-solving capabilities. Demonstrated initiative to learn new skills and innovative technologies. Tact and discretion essential as well as ability to handle confidential information in an appropriate manner.
